Description

Indulge in the delicate flavors of Earl Grey and lavender with this exquisite London Fog Cake. Moist Earl Grey tea-infused cake layers are soaked in a fragrant Earl Grey milk mixture and frosted with a luscious lavender cream cheese frosting.


Ingredients

Units Scale

For the Earl Grey Cake

  • 3 tbsp (12 g) Earl Grey tea
  • 1 tbsp (2 g) culinary lavender
  • 2 1/4 cups (282 g) all-purpose flour, spooned and leveled
  • 1 1/2 tsp baking powder
  • 1/4 tsp baking soda
  • 1/2 tsp salt
  • 10 tbsp (140 g) unsalted butter, softened
  • 1 1/2 cups (300 g) granulated white sugar
  • 3 eggs, at room temperature
  • 1 tbsp vanilla bean paste
  • 1 cup (240 ml) buttermilk

For the Earl Grey Milk Soak

  • 1/2 cup whole milk
  • 2 tbsp (8 g) Earl Grey tea
  • 1/2 tbsp (1 g) culinary lavender
  • 1/2 cup (150 g) sweetened condensed milk
  • 1/2 tsp vanilla bean paste

For the Lavender Cream Cheese Frosting

  • 1 tbsp (2 g) culinary lavender
  • 1 cup (224 g) unsalted butter, softened
  • 8 oz (226 g) cream cheese, cold
  • 2 cups (260 g) powdered sugar
  • 1 tsp vanilla bean paste
  • purple food coloring (optional)

Instructions

  1. For the Earl Grey Cake – Preheat oven. Prepare pan. Process tea and lavender. Mix dry ingredients. Cream butter and sugar. Add eggs and vanilla. Alternate buttermilk and dry ingredients. Bake.
  2. For the Earl Grey Milk Soak – Heat milk. Steep tea and lavender. Strain. Add condensed milk and vanilla.
  3. For the Lavender Cream Cheese Frosting – Process lavender. Beat butter. Add cream cheese, sugar, lavender, and vanilla. Color if desired.
  4. Assembling the Cake – Level cake. Poke holes. Pour milk soak. Frost. Slice and serve.

Notes

  • Ensure all ingredients are at room temperature for best results.
  • For a stronger lavender flavor, infuse milk with lavender overnight.
  • Adjust frosting sweetness to taste by adding more or less powdered sugar.
